My 2005 Range Rover Sport has developed a fault whereby the parking hydraulic parking brake has applied itself without me pulling the swith in the vehicle. I am being told by my usual garage in Dubai, that the motor is at fault, but that the whole assembly including the control unit will need to be changed as it comes as a complete assembly. The total cost for the part is in the region of 800 Pounds. Has anyone else come across this problem, and can offer any advice or workaround. I assume the unit cannot be disconnected as a temporary measure until I can find a more competitive price?
